For stopping killing your time you must learn and focus on
time management skills that are very essential and helpful for you. I refer
here some point you can consider:
Make your goals- If you have a goal
in life and you are serious about it and working for that persistently, you
will have no leisure to kill. Goals may be long term or short term. I recommend
you to make short term goals on a daily basis, achieve them than go for the long term
this makes your habit to win. This will change your perspective as well as your
attitude towards yourself and life.
A powerful morning
routine- This is the most effective and common habit in prominent personalities
they all have a powerful morning routine; it will change your full day
performance. “The 5 am club” by Robin Sharma is the best book to develop a great
morning routine. He discusses 20/20/20 rule which is most effective. Wake up
early morning, excise, meditation, read or listen good book and make your own full-day to-do-list. Prioritize your all tasks and save your energy for extra works.
Be a reader and
observer- you can develop a habit of learning and learn a skill to
observe things surrounding us. Whenever you have free time get a good book or
audio podcasts form where you can learn a lot of great things.
